Matching grant to support St. Clare Center Food Pantry

December 01, 2022 

Victory Lane Ford recently announced they will match up to $7,500 in donations to HSHS St. Francis Foundation collected now through December 31 to benefit the St. Clare Center Food Pantry. 

Paula Endress, director of HSHS St. Francis Foundation, shared, “We are most appreciative to Victory Lane Ford for this generous challenge grant, which will enable donors to double the value of their contribution. Thank you to all who make a contribution to help those less fortunate in our community.” 

Gene Hebenstreit, owner of Victory Lane Ford, believes it is more important now than ever during these challenging economic times to make sure the pantry has enough food to meet their needs for the upcoming holiday season and winter months. “Through the help of many generous donors, they have consistently met the challenge, so this year I’m increasing the challenge amount from $5,000 to $7,500,” said Hebenstreit.

The St. Clare Center Food Pantry is located at 603 N. Madison Street in Litchfield and is a ministry of HSHS St. Francis Hospital. The pantry serves residents of Montgomery and Macoupin counties. For further information about the pantry, call 217-324-2800
